What role do non-governmental organizations (NGOs) play in international politics? 🔊
Non-governmental organizations (NGOs) play a significant role in international politics by promoting a range of issues such as human rights, environmental protection, and sustainable development. They contribute to policy discussions, influence international agreements, and provide humanitarian assistance. NGOs often advocate for marginalized populations and hold governments accountable for their actions, which can pressure states to comply with global standards. Their grassroots connections and specialized knowledge enhance international cooperation and provide critical insights on socio-economic issues, thus shaping both domestic and international policy agendas.
